Billy's class had a field trip today to a small local amusement park. His teacher wrote that he went on every ride and was asking friends to sit with him on different rides, which they did.

I was so pleased!

It's just the little social things that most people take for granted... yet they are such big steps for autistic children!! :cheer2:
